Fous Paradise

One of Rouba Saadeh’s most talked projects is Le Paradis Des Fous. The French moniker, “The Paradise of Fools,” has been described as a Beirut designer concept store or creative retail initiative in public profiles. It is often cited as her main entrepreneurial venture.

That Saadeh was not limited by fashion structures makes the endeavour remarkable. Concept stores require knowledge of consumers, brand positioning, taste, and selection. Retail depends on loyal customers, currency flow, timing, and location, which involves risk.

Many public profiles indicate that Le Paradis Des Fous operated between 2013 and 2014. Due to limited company records and long-term financial data, the project should not be inflated. It shows her passion for entrepreneurship and independent fashion curation, so it remains an important part of her public career.

Work with Elie Saab

One of Lebanon’s most famous fashion houses, Elie Saab, is also associated with Rouba Saadeh. Her career has been linked to ready-to-wear studio work at ELIE SAAB, a couture, bridalwear, and red-carpet fashion designer. However, a ready-to-wear workshop requires discipline and pace.

Ready-to-wear is essential to a fashion establishment, but less visible than celebrity gowns. It may involve sample coordination, collection planning, fitting coordination, team communication, and design and manufacturing considerations. In addition to judgement, studio jobs require organization.

This part of Saadeh’s career makes her biography longer than many celebrity profiles. She is more than a fashion-loving ex-celebrity spouse. Her documented job places her in a revered professional atmosphere affiliated with a leading Middle Eastern luxury fashion brand.

Marriage to Michele Morrone

Marriage to Michele Morrone changed Rouba Saadeh’s public image. After appearing in 365 Days, Italian actor, singer, and model Morrone became famous worldwide. Fans wanted to know about his ex-wife, kids, and family after that project’s global success.

Many believe Saadeh and Morrone married in 2014. They started dating before Morrone’s global fame. His profession was still developing, and their family life was not international news.

The divorce occurred in 2018. Morrone later revealed his inner suffering after his divorce, which entertainment media has often repeated. Saadeh has not publicly discussed the divorce’s private causes.

Child and Family Life

Sons of Rouba Saadeh and Michele Morrone are Marcus and Brando. Marcus is reported to have been born around 2014, and Brando in 2017. Due to her children, Morrone’s personal life is often linked to Saadeh.
